Overview and Pricing

east-zion-brushy-cove-jeep-adventure

The East Zion: Brushy Cove Jeep Adventure offers an exhilarating 1.5-hour experience, priced from $99.00 per person.

Guests can reserve their spot now and pay later, with the option to c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.

The tour accommodates up to 9 people and features a live guide who provides insights into the region’s history and geology.

Participants will traverse wild terrain in a customized Jeep Wrangler, ascending over 2,000 feet for breathtaking views of East Zion and exploring the backcountry of the national park.

Experience Highlights

east-zion-brushy-cove-jeep-adventure

Traverse wild terrain in a customized Jeep Wrangler as you ascend over 2,000 feet for breathtaking views of East Zion.

Explore the backcountry of East Zion National Park, where you’ll have the chance to see prominent landmarks like West Temple, Checkerboard Mesa, and the Narrows.

Along the way, your knowledgeable guide will provide insights into the region’s fascinating geography and land formations.

With potential wildlife sightings including Mule Deer, Wild Turkey, Elk, Mountain Lion, and Black Bear, this thrilling adventure offers an immersive glimpse into the rugged beauty of Southern Utah.

Tour Details

east-zion-brushy-cove-jeep-adventure

This thrilling Jeep adventure accommodates groups of up to 9 people, ensuring an intimate and personalized experience.

You’ll have a live tour guide providing insights into the history and geology of the region. With a bit of luck, you might spot Mule Deer, Wild Turkey, Elk, Mountain Lion, or Black Bear along the way.

To keep you comfortable, the tour provides booster seats for children under 3 and complimentary snacks and bottled water.

Just be sure to dress warmly if you’re visiting during the non-summer months, as the tour won’t run in bad weather conditions.
